Practical Decluttering Strategies



Having assessed your existing mess, the following action is to carry out sensible decluttering methods that assist in a more arranged living space. Minimalism. One reliable approach is the "Four-Box" strategy, where you designate 4 boxes labeled: keep, contribute, garbage, and relocate. This approach encourages fast decision-making and makes sure items are classified properly


Another strategy is the "One in, One out" rule, which specifies that for every new product acquired, an existing thing must be eliminated. This concept assists preserve equilibrium and prevents accumulation with time. In addition, take into consideration the "30-Day Minimalism Video Game," where you get rid of one thing on the very first day, two on the 2nd, etc, cumulatively promoting a feeling of accomplishment.


For those that deal with psychological attachments to properties, the "Sentimental Worth" approach can be helpful. Restriction yourself to a particular variety of valued things, permitting you to appreciate their value without overwhelming your room. Develop a normal decluttering timetable, whether regular monthly or seasonally, to preserve a clutter-free atmosphere. By employing these strategies, you can create a more efficient and tranquil space, inevitably enhancing clarity in your day-to-day life.
